The eye colour looks fine as when they are blind the eye should be a cloudy white colour. Does the eye in person look cloudy white? It can even be a tiny bit cloudy. What is her age as that might affect it? Do you know her parents' health history? Finally where did you buy her?
 
What have you done to determine that she doesn’t see out of that eye?
Accommodation to light is a good thing, because it usually means there is not total blindness.... with a reactive pupil you would expect that they can at least see shadows or shapes.
